Folder Controller Access Control mechanisms are essential for safeguarding sensitive data and maintaining the integrity of an organization's information assets. These protocols define who has permission to read, write, execute specific folders and files within a system. By implementing robust Access Control policies, administrators can limit data exposure. Effective Access Control strengthens overall system defenses by ensuring that only authorized users can conduct actions on relevant folders and files.
- Configuring Role-Based Access Control (RBAC) allows administrators to assign different levels of access based on user roles and responsibilities.
- Regularly reviewing access permissions ensures that users only have the necessary level of access required for their tasks.
- Multi-factor authentication adds an extra layer of security by requiring users to provide multiple forms of identification before accessing sensitive folders.

Strengthening Data Security with Access Control
In today's digital landscape, safeguarding sensitive information is paramount. Robust authorization control mechanisms form a cornerstone of effective data security strategies. By implementing granular access permissions, organizations can limit who has access to certain datasets and resources. This tiered approach prevents unauthorized exposure of confidential information and minimizes the risk of data breaches. Access control measures should encompass a range of safeguards, including multi-factor authentication, role-based access rights, and regular monitoring to ensure ongoing security.
Configuring Granular Access Permissions
Fine-grained access control are vital for securing your systems. By defining granular access permissions, you may precisely regulate who has access to what resources. This reduces the risk of unauthorized access and preserves your confidential data.
- Configure role-based permission structures to categorize users based on their functions.
- Define clear permissions for each position, ensuring that individuals only have access to the information they need to perform theirtasks.
- Utilize attribute-based access control (ABAC) to granularly define permissions based on characteristics, features, and the environment of access requests.
Regularly review your permission frameworks to uncover any gaps.
Streamlined Access Management System
A centralized access management system facilitates organizations by providing a singular point of control for user authorization. This systemic approach enhances security by implementing multi-layered access controls, minimizing the risk of unauthorized entry. By centralizing user management, organizations can improve their identity and privileges management processes, leading to increased efficiency and reduced security vulnerabilities.
Advantages of a centralized access management system include:
* Simplified user provisioning and de-provisioning
* Detailed access control policies based on user roles and responsibilities
* Immediate audit trails for monitoring user activity and detecting potential breaches
* Enhanced compliance with industry regulations and standards
* Lowered administrative overhead and costs
